Depends on the cookie. I'm starting my Christmas cooking today. When I'm done, I'll box them up and put them in our attached garage on a shelf, since it's cooler out there. The only cookie that I'll wait until Wednesday to make is the shortbread, since it's better when it's fresh.
I made cookies Tuesday and some people won't get them until today. The people who got them yesterday said they were great...so hoping they last a while. I put them in cookie "boxes" but put cellophane all around them to keep them fresh.
You could make them and pop them in the freezer in a freezer bag. I made cookies two weeks before Thanksgiving and then took them to my parents house. They thawed on the way there and tasted just like the day I made them.
